Short answer: Prescription glasses frames are HSA-eligible if prescribed by a qualified eye care professional, but non-prescription or cosmetic frames may not qualify.

Understanding HSA Coverage for Vision Care

When it comes to health savings accounts (HSAs), one common question that arises is whether glasses frames are covered under an HSA. The answer to this question lies in understanding the guidelines and regulations set by the Internal Revenue Service (IRS) regarding HSA-eligible expenses.

HSAs are a tax-advantaged way to save money for qualified medical expenses. While HSA funds can be used for a variety of medical expenses, including prescription eyeglasses, there are specific rules surrounding what is considered an eligible expense when it comes to vision care.

Prescription vs. Non-Prescription Glasses Eligibility

Generally, the cost of prescription glasses, including frames and lenses, is considered an eligible expense under an HSA as long as it is prescribed by a qualified eye care professional. However, when it comes to non-prescription glasses or purely cosmetic frames, the rules may vary.
